Essential Job Duties(Manage the complex sales process of da Vinci® Surgical Systems into new hospitals and upgrades into existing hospitals
- Build support from surgeons and administration for da Vinci® Surgery. Identify key institutions, generate market awareness, and drive sales of the da Vinci® Surgical System within an assigned sales territory
- Effectively manage transition of initial sale and installation to the sales team to drive procedural volume and growth
- Achieve quarterly sales targets
- Partner with the da Vinci® Area Sales Director to develop a sales plan for their local territory
- Build surgical advocacy teams at each hospital
- Develop initial contact and relationship with CEO and senior hospital administrators
- Organize and manage the sales process
- Develop knowledge of primary OR procedures
- Make business case for system purchase
- Resolve contractual issues and coordinate system installation upon purchase approval
- Handle all communications and administrative follow-up
Required Skills and Experience
- Bachelor’s degree required
- Minimum of 5 years sales experience preference for experience in healthcare capital sales
- Knowledge of the operating room environment
- Proven successful track record in capital medical equipment sales
- Sales management experience a plus
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
- Ability to travel up to 50%, dependent upon account distribution
- Success in introducing new technologies to the market is a plus

U.S. Export Controls Disclaimer: In accordance with the U.S. Export Administration Regulations (15 CFR §743.13(b)), some roles at Intuitive Surgical may be subject to U.S. export controls for prospective employees who are nationals from countries currently on embargo or sanctions status.
Certain information you provide as part of the application will be used for purposes of determining whether Intuitive Surgical will need to (i) obtain an export license from the U.S. Government on your behalf (note: the government’s licensing process can take 3 to 6+ months) or (ii) implement a Technology Control Plan (“TCP”) (note: typically adds 2 weeks to the hiring process).
For any Intuitive role subject to export controls, final offers are contingent upon obtaining an approved export license and/or an executed TCP prior to the prospective employee’s start date, which may or may not be flexible, and within a timeframe that does not unreasonably impede the hiring need. If applicable, candidates will be notified and instructed on any requirements for these purposes.

PublicIntuitive Surgical, Inc. is an American biotechnology company that develops, manufactures, and markets robotic products designed to improve clinical outcomes of patients through minimally invasive surgery, most notably with the da Vinci Surgical System.
